Apple Upside-Down Cake

Bake this easy Apple Upside-Down Cake recipe! Sweet apples and a buttery brown sugar topping make for a cozy fall dessert.

Servings 6
Calories 231 kcal
- 2 7 ounce packages Martha White Apple Cider Muffin Mix
- 2 eggs
- 1 cup milk
- 3 small Macintosh apples
- 1/3 cup brown sugar packed
- 1/3 cup butter
- 7 " round high baking dish at least 3" deep
Preheat your oven to 350° F.
Cut your butter into cubes, place into your baking dish, and set in your preheated oven for 5-5 minutes or until butter is melted.
Sprinkle your brown sugar over your butter.
Slice your apples from the top of the apple and use an apple corer or small cookie cutter to remove the center.
Place about 5 apple slices into your butter and brown sugar mix.
Mix together your muffin mixes, eggs, and milk and pour over your apples.
Bake for 50-55 minutes or until a toothpick test comes out clean 8. Slice and enjoy with a cup of coffee or warm apple cider.
